What they do

An Accountant organizes and maintains financial records and prepares financial statements for companies and organizations. Works as a public accountant (prepares financial documents where public disclosure is required by law, such as business balance sheets and tax returns), management accountant (prepares financial information for internal use by a company) or government accountant (maintains records for government agencies).

Role:
The Accounting Associate supports the Corporate Accounting team in the day-to-day accounting operations of the company and its related entities. The role assists with accounts payable, monthly and quarterly close activities, account reconciliations, cash management, payroll-related accounting, vendor administration, compliance reporting, and recurring financial reporting. The position works closely with the Corporate Accounting Supervisor, Corporate Controller, other members of the accounting team, and internal departments to help ensure accounting activities are completed accurately and on time.
Responsibilities:
Assist with monthly and quarterly close activities, including journal entries, accruals, and supporting schedules. Support cash management activities, including cash receipts, weekly cash reporting, and cash flow schedules. Prepare bank, balance sheet, and other account reconciliations; research and resolve reconciling items. Maintain monthly account reconciliation workbooks and organized supporting documentation. Assist with intercompany accounting, reconciliations, and balance tracking for assigned entities. Prepare recurring schedules and analyses used in monthly, quarterly, board, and management reporting. Assist with sales tax, income tax, insurance, audit, and other compliance-related schedules and requests. Research and resolve accounting, vendor, payment, and reconciliation discrepancies. Process accounts payable invoices and payment requests, including review of coding, approvals, and supporting documentation. Support process documentation, workflow improvements, special projects, and other departmental priorities.
